Which of the following is the best step to make first when simplifying the expression 0.6 - 1/3 A. Subtract the numbers. B. Divide 6 by 3. C. Write 0.6 as a fraction. D. WRITE1/3 AS 0.3

OK. What part of this is giving you trouble?
IM TRYING TO FIGURE OUT WHICH IS THE BEST STEP TO MAKE FIRST
With these, there are a few good question to ask yourself. For example, "Is this a valid step?" and "Can this be done first?" Take "Subtract the numbers." Is it valid? Well, you can do subtraction so sort of. However, the things are not in a form where subtraction just happens... which means that it can't be done first. Now try that on the others.
